Subject: Quickstore 4.2 — bloom filter now fronts the KV layer

Plugin authors: starting with this release, Quickstore places a bloom filter ahead of the key-value store. Negative lookups return faster; false positives fall through safely. No API changes are required on your side. Verify your plugin against the staging build referenced below.

session token of fahif-tadup = htk3_9c7

## Formula sandbox tuning

User-supplied formulas in Gridmoor execute inside a restricted interpreter with hard ceilings on time, memory, and call depth. Reviewers should confirm any change to these ceilings is justified in the PR description, since raising them widens the abuse surface. Defaults were chosen from production traces. The current limits are as follows.

limits module of tafog-fawip:
WEIGHTS = {
    "julix": 57,
    "lamys": 992,
    "kasvan": 209,
    "quenok": 750,
    "alddor": 259,
    "oliath": 1009,
    "wenix": 815,
}

Checklist item 7 — Off-site run, branch server replacement

Collect the replacement server (model Corvane R5, crated) from the Ashfell depot loading bay and transport it to the Mirebrook branch office. Verify the tamper seals on the crate before departure and record the seal numbers in the run log. Do not stack other freight on the crate. On arrival, the courier must complete the hand-over exactly as stated in the confidential line below.

dispatch memo: the eliok quenok courier leaves the sorael aldath belion tammir casix gileth queniel jorath ledger at gate 9299 under passcode 897989